Hyundai Accent

Ah, the Hyundai Accent! This is a popular choice, especially for those looking for a reliable and fuel-efficient car. The 2022 model year of the Hyundai Accent is available in several variants, and typically offers a great balance of affordability and features. It's an excellent choice for city driving and daily commutes. The exterior design of the Accent features a sleek and modern look, with a distinctive front grille and stylish headlights. Inside, you'll find a well-designed cabin with comfortable seating and practical features. The Accent often comes equipped with an infotainment system, usually with a touchscreen display, and connectivity options like Apple CarPlay and Android Auto, depending on the trim level. Regarding performance, the Hyundai Accent often has a fuel-efficient engine, making it a budget-friendly choice for fuel consumption. Safety features usually include airbags, anti-lock brakes (ABS), and electronic stability control (ESC). The Accent generally offers good value for its price, making it a popular choice for young professionals and families alike. The Accent is a solid choice if you're looking for a compact sedan that doesn't break the bank while still offering good looks and practical features. Keep an eye out for updates on the latest model year. The Hyundai Accent remains a solid choice for those prioritizing fuel efficiency and everyday usability.

Hyundai Elantra

Next up, we have the Hyundai Elantra, which often steps things up a notch from the Accent. The Elantra usually falls into the compact sedan segment, but often offers a bit more space, comfort, and advanced features. The 2022 Hyundai Elantra is known for its bold and stylish design, with a unique front fascia and a coupe-like roofline, giving it a sporty appearance. Inside, the Elantra offers a more refined cabin with premium materials and a host of technology features. This usually includes a larger touchscreen infotainment system, advanced driver-assistance systems (ADAS), and a digital instrument cluster in some trims. The Elantra may come with a more powerful engine compared to the Accent, providing a more engaging driving experience. Fuel efficiency remains a priority, and the Elantra often delivers respectable mileage figures. The Hyundai Elantra typically comes equipped with advanced safety features, including multiple airbags, blind-spot monitoring, and lane-keeping assist. The Elantra is a fantastic option if you're looking for a more upscale and feature-rich compact sedan. It offers a blend of style, comfort, and advanced technology that sets it apart from the competition. It's often a bit more expensive than the Accent, but the added features and enhanced driving experience make it well worth the investment. The Elantra is perfect for those who want a blend of practicality and luxury.

Hyundai Sonata

Now, let's talk about the Hyundai Sonata. The Sonata is typically positioned as a mid-size sedan, offering more space, comfort, and premium features compared to the Accent and Elantra. The 2022 Hyundai Sonata features a sleek and modern design with a distinctive cascading grille and a flowing silhouette. The interior is spacious and well-appointed, with high-quality materials and a host of advanced technology features. The Sonata usually includes a large touchscreen infotainment system, a digital instrument cluster, and often offers a range of ADAS features like adaptive cruise control, lane-keeping assist, and automatic emergency braking. The Sonata often comes with a more powerful engine, providing ample performance for both city and highway driving. Fuel efficiency is still a priority, and the Sonata balances power with respectable mileage figures. The Hyundai Sonata usually comes equipped with a comprehensive suite of safety features, including multiple airbags, blind-spot monitoring, and forward collision avoidance assist. The Sonata is a great choice if you're looking for a comfortable and spacious sedan with premium features and a refined driving experience. It's ideal for families and those who frequently travel long distances. The Sonata provides a luxurious experience without breaking the bank. With its combination of style, comfort, and advanced technology, the Sonata delivers exceptional value in the mid-size sedan segment.

2022 Hyundai Sedan Specs and Features: A Quick Comparison

To give you a better idea, here's a quick comparison of the specs and features you might expect from each model. Keep in mind that specifications can vary based on the specific trim level and any updates made during the 2022 model year. Always refer to official Hyundai Philippines brochures and websites for the most accurate and up-to-date information.

Feature Hyundai Accent Hyundai Elantra Hyundai Sonata
Segment Compact Compact Mid-size
Engine Typically 1.4L-1.6L Typically 1.6L-2.0L Typically 2.5L
Power (approx.) 100-120 hp 120-150 hp 180-190 hp
Transmission Manual/Automatic Automatic Automatic
Infotainment Touchscreen, Apple CarPlay/Android Auto Touchscreen, Apple CarPlay/Android Auto Touchscreen, Apple CarPlay/Android Auto
Safety Features Airbags, ABS, ESC Airbags, ABS, ESC, ADAS Airbags, ABS, ESC, ADAS
Fuel Efficiency Excellent Good Good
Price (approx.) Affordable Mid-range Premium
